What is an Unsecured Business Loan?

Definition

An unsecured business loan is a type of financing that does not require collateral. Instead, lenders evaluate the borrower’s creditworthiness and business performance.

Broader Explanation

Unlike secured loans, where lenders can seize assets in case of default, an unsecured business loan relies on trust, financial data, and credit history. This makes it ideal for businesses that lack valuable assets but demonstrate strong financial potential.

Precise Definition

An unsecured business loan is one granted without collateral and is based on the business’s performance and creditworthiness.

Potential Drawbacks to Consider

While an unsecured business loan provides many benefits, it is important to understand the potential drawbacks before making a decision. Being aware of these limitations will help you use an unsecured business loan more strategically.

Higher Interest Rates

One of the most notable disadvantages of an unsecured business loan is the higher interest rates. Since lenders are not protected by collateral, they take on more risk when approving the loan.

As a result:

  • Interest rates are generally higher than secured loans
  • Businesses with lower credit scores may face even higher rates
  • Total repayment costs can increase significantly over time

To manage this, it is advisable to:

  • Compare multiple unsecured business loan lenders
  • Use an unsecured business loan calculator to estimate total costs
  • Choose repayment terms that align with your cash flow

Understanding unsecured business loan rates before borrowing can help you avoid financial strain.

Lower Borrowing Limits

Another limitation of an unsecured business loan is that the amount you can borrow may be lower compared to secured loans. Because lenders are not backed by collateral, they often limit the loan size to reduce their risk.

This means:

  • Large-scale projects may require additional funding sources
  • Businesses with limited revenue may qualify for smaller amounts
  • Loan limits are often tied to your financial performance

While this may seem restrictive, it can also encourage responsible borrowing and prevent businesses from taking on excessive debt.

Types of Unsecured Business Loans Available in 2026

In 2026, there are several types of unsecured business loan options available, each designed to meet different business needs. Understanding these options will help you choose the most suitable financing solution.

Term Loans

A term loan is one of the most common types of unsecured business loans. It involves borrowing a fixed amount of money and repaying it over a set period with interest.

Key features include:

  • Fixed or variable interest rates
  • Predictable monthly payments
  • Defined repayment schedule

Term loans are ideal for:

  • Business expansion
  • Equipment purchases
  • Long-term investments

This type of unsecured business loan is best suited for businesses that need a lump sum of capital and prefer structured repayment.

Business Lines of Credit

A business line of credit is a flexible form of unsecured business loan that allows you to borrow funds as needed, up to a predetermined limit.

Key benefits include:

  • Pay interest only on the amount used
  • Reusable credit as you repay
  • Flexible access to funds

This option is perfect for:

  • Managing cash flow fluctuations
  • Covering short-term expenses
  • Handling seasonal business needs

A line of credit provides ongoing financial support, making it one of the most adaptable unsecured loans available.

Merchant Cash Advances

A merchant cash advance is a unique type of unsecured business loan where repayment is based on a percentage of your daily sales.

How it works:

  • You receive a lump sum upfront
  • Repayment is automatically deducted from daily transactions
  • Payments adjust based on your revenue

This option is ideal for:

  • Retail businesses
  • Restaurants
  • Businesses with consistent card sales

While convenient, merchant cash advances often come with higher costs, so it’s important to evaluate them carefully.

Invoice Financing

Invoice financing is another form of unsecured business loan that allows businesses to borrow against unpaid invoices.

Key features include:

  • Immediate access to cash tied up in invoices
  • Improved cash flow
  • Reduced waiting time for customer payments

This type of unsecured business loan is especially useful for:

  • B2B businesses
  • Companies with long payment cycles
  • Businesses facing cash flow gaps

By leveraging outstanding invoices, businesses can maintain steady operations without waiting for clients to pay.
